Three supports es6 modules, including a rollup, three.module.js. It does not provide a minified version, however.
This is a feature request to include three.module.min.js in the distribution.
The lack of three.module.min.js may be a result of the popular minifiers initially not being able to minify es6. This is no longer the case, see: butternut/squash https://github.com/Rich-Harris/butternut. Also uglify-es is a version of uglify-js that can minify es6+.

That seems pretty nonstandard to me; better practice is for users to do minification after tree-shaking in their build. The subset of users who are going to copy/paste scripts without a build step AND use ES modules is diminishingly small, and I think we can avoid adding a new build artifact for them by recommending CDNs like JSDelivr and Unpkg instead. Context from #17276:
@Rich-Harris wrote:
Essentially, the only browser that doesn't support class natively (with usage that isn't a rounding error, at least) is IE11. Which means that if you transpile ES2015 down to ES5, you're penalising (with a larger build) the 98% for the sake of the 2%.
I'd advocate for leaving class untranspiled, and maybe having a separate three.legacy.js build that is transpiled, where it doesn't matter so much about the extra bytes.
@mrdoob replied:
That's kind of the plan. three.module.js is ES6 with modules/classes. But we're trying to produce the same three.js and three.min.js we currently have.
I replied:
Should there also be a three.module.min.js, then, to serve as the new standard save-bandwidth build?

I've experimented a bit with with three.module.min.js
and it seems the project will introduce a major issue if this build artifact is provided. Consider the following setup:
import * as THREE from "https://cdn.jsdelivr.net/npm/[email protected]/build/three.module.min.js";
import { OrbitControls } from "https://cdn.jsdelivr.net/npm/[email protected]/examples/jsm/controls/OrbitControls.js";
As you can see in this live example, the setup will import three.js
twice. The app loads three.module.min.js
but also three.module.js
since OrbitControls
like any other example module internally points to it.
Hence, providing three.module.min.js
will only lead to duplicate imports and thus undefined behavior in user level code. It really seems better if code minification is handled on app level as part of a proper (node.js based) build.
@mrdoob I would say this issue can be closed. The concept of having a minified core build is not appropriate in context of ES6 modules. Code minification/obfuscation needs to be handled on app level.
